Output 87a693409e3671738783d5682e7a0043cdaf4b1cb31aaf7f4ff8a3a1498e6583:6

value
3609237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1879b77964932a5e68486eed46dc3898d7b563 OP_EQUAL
address
3EjdsZS4FZpzYQyhN1SpDSNPL2gXTC2VUv
transaction
87a693409e3671738783d5682e7a0043cdaf4b1cb31aaf7f4ff8a3a1498e6583
spent
true